What Happens After the Procedure?
Immediately after the session, the treated area may appear slightly red or feel sensitive. These effects are common and usually occur because the skin has responded to the micro-injections. In many cases, mild swelling, small bumps, or tenderness can also appear temporarily as the skin adjusts to the procedure.
During the first few hours, it is helpful to avoid touching the treated area unnecessarily. Keeping the skin clean and following recommended skincare practices can support a smoother recovery period. Moreover, protecting the skin from harsh environmental factors helps reduce irritation while the natural repair process takes place.
Early Recovery Tips for Better Results
Mesotherapy treatment recovery often depends on simple but effective aftercare habits. While the procedure itself is designed to be gentle, giving the skin enough time to settle can improve comfort and support the desired outcome. The following steps can help during the initial recovery stage:
- Avoid excessive rubbing, scratching, or pressure on the treated area.
- Keep the skin protected from strong sunlight and use suitable sun protection.
- Drink enough water to support overall skin wellness.
- Follow the recommended skincare routine without introducing harsh products.
- Avoid activities that may increase irritation immediately after the session.
Additionally, avoiding intense heat exposure, such as saunas or very hot showers, may be beneficial during the early recovery period. Gentle care allows the skin to recover naturally without unnecessary stress.

Common Recovery Concerns and How to Manage Them
Although mesotherapy is a minimally invasive cosmetic procedure, temporary reactions may occur. Understanding these possible experiences can make the recovery phase less stressful. Mild redness, sensitivity, or swelling are among the most commonly reported short-term effects.
To manage these concerns, individuals can:
- Use gentle skincare products suitable for sensitive skin.
- Avoid direct sun exposure during the healing period.
- Follow professional guidance regarding cleansing and moisturizing.
- Allow the skin enough time to recover before scheduling additional cosmetic procedures.
Transitioning back into a normal routine is usually possible when the skin feels comfortable. However, rushing the process or ignoring aftercare advice may affect the overall recovery experience.
